Cincinnati (USA) - Czech tennis player Jiří Lehečka will face world number six Ben Shelton from the USA today to advance to the quarterfinals of the Masters tournament in Cincinnati. The winner of the previous tournament in Montreal defeated Spaniard Roberto Bautista 7:6, 6:3 in Wednesday's third-round match.

Spanishman Roberto Bautista said goodbye this Wednesday to Cincinnati's ATP 1,000 when he lost to American Ben Shelton by 7-6(3) and 6-3 in an hour and 49 minutes and after a third round match marked by rain from start to finish.
